Output 9989126021b00459db81bb6745b4ba83066d121bc4643df124c8dda49d99423e:2

value
66263426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6408a35082cfd3e839f9399bb8af560399cfc30b OP_EQUAL
address
MH269ngBewLXQ1uFXU6vzE9eoL53Vp3FnM
transaction
9989126021b00459db81bb6745b4ba83066d121bc4643df124c8dda49d99423e
spent
true